What Does It Mean to Be Blessed?



 



As a Christian... What's a good



definition of  “success?”



How does one know if their



life has been blessed?



 



Is it based on the words that



someone has spoken?



Has your life been humbled...



and your heart broken?



 



Have you measured up to the way



 God really wants you to be?



Are you in search of HIS righteousness?



With a desire to be holy?



 



It's more than just



doing a "church routine."



Or coming to church every week,



and doing the "Sunday thing."



 



True Godly success is not based



on a church building.



Nor getting involved on things



that are rather "appealing."



 



It comes from falling in love with



Jesus and making him Lord.



It's only in Christ where your



treasures should be stored.



 



Allow his holy word and spirit to daily lead.



He alone can bring the blessing



you so really need.



 



Listen to his word and obey his voice.



Above everything else...



He must be your first choice!



 



Only then will your life be blessed



the way God intended.



His life for yours has



already been committed.



 



Enter into his holiness!



 His peace and rest.



For what he gives you is



always the best!



 



By Jim Pemberton   (c) 2015

About the Poet
I and my wife have 4 grown children and currently live in the Pacific Northwest. I've spent much of my life doing volunteer work in the food distribution for the needy among local churches. Many of the poems I've written are a reflection of times of adversity as a reminder of God's love and faithfulness. I've found many opportunities to share my poems with those who are hurting and discouraged. I'm thankful for the reports of many of the poems touching people's lives.
